CATALOG

芯步的壁挂语音音箱通过 HTTP 接口开放控制能力,可以像调用普通 API 一样集成到仓库管理系统中。以下方案涵盖网络选型、签名鉴权、核心命令调用,以及入库、出库、异常报警三个典型场景的触发逻辑。

仓库语音通知解决方案:集成芯步10W壁挂音箱

1. 背景与挑战

在现代仓库管理中,传统的蜂鸣器或屏幕提示往往存在“信息盲区”,工人容易错过关键指令。利用芯步智能语音音箱,可以将 ERP 或 WMS 系统中的文本指令实时转化为高保真语音,实现“任务找人”

本方案的目标是解决如何通过 HTTP 接口,将 UNI-YY-YX-BG-LAN-10W(有线网版)WiFi版 音箱快速集成到现有仓储项目中

2. 核心集成架构

  • 通信协议: HTTPS(确保数据传输安全)。

  • 数据格式: JSON / Plain Text。

  • 网络环境: 支持云端 API 或 纯局域网环境(私有化部署,适合内网隔离的仓库)

逻辑流程图:

WMS/ERP 触发事件 -> 后端服务计算签名 -> 调用芯步 API -> 音箱接收指令 -> TTS 语音播报

3. 详细集成步骤

3.1 设备选型与网络配置

在仓库场景下,推荐以下两种连接方式:

  • 有线网络版: 信号稳定,适合机柜密集、WiFi 干扰大的环境,通过网线接入交换机即可

  • 无线 WiFi 版: 部署灵活,适合货架移动频繁或布线困难的区域,支持 2.4GHz 频段

3.2 API 接口调试与鉴权

芯步的开放接口本质是标准的 HTTP 请求,核心在于签名计算以防止伪造请求。

  • 请求地址:https://api.thingboot.com/{AppID}/device/control/

  • 鉴权参数:

    • ts:当前 Unix 时间戳(秒)。

    • signmd5( md5(AppSecret) + ts )

  • 请求体参数:

    • device:设备唯一 ID(在芯步控制台获取)。

    • order:JSON 命令对象。

代码示意(伪代码):

3.3 核心语音命令封装(TTS)

音箱无需预先录音,直接推送文本即可朗读。推荐使用 play:gbk:16 指令(16代表音量,范围0-16),支持中文、数字、金额自动优化读法

命令封装表

功能场景命令格式(Order JSON)参数说明
语音播报{"play:gbk:16":"需要播报的文字"}音量范围 0-16,数值越大声音越大
音量调节{"volume": 10}全局调整,范围 0-16
播放警示音{"alert": 2}内置 5 种警示音,索引 1-5
播放铃声{"ring": 3}内置 5 种铃声,索引 1-5
紧急停止{"stop": ""}立即停止当前播报

4. 仓库业务场景集成实战

为了让音箱真正成为仓库助手,将以下业务逻辑写入你的后端触发器:

第一种场景:入库扫码自动播报
  • 触发条件: 手持终端(PDA)扫描入库单号,系统校验数量。

  • 语音指令:{"play:gbk:12":"采购订单 20241001 已入库,总数量 500 件,请核对上架"}

  • 价值: 确认收货无需回头查看电脑屏幕。

第二种场景:缺货与紧急补货
  • 触发条件: 系统检测到拣货区库存低于预设阈值。

  • 语音指令(支持多设备广播):"device": "device_id_1,device_id_2"{"play:gbk:15":"紧急补货通知,高位货架 A03 区,纸箱缺货"}

  • 价值: 叉车司机在行进中即可获知任务位置。

第三种场景:防错播报
  • 触发条件: 员工扫描条码与系统订单不符(如发错货)。

  • 语音指令: 先播报警示音 {"alert": 4} ,间隔 1 秒后播报 {"play:gbk:16":"错误警告,商品条码不匹配,请重新扫描"}

5. 高级应用与优化

  1. 音色与语速调节:仓库环境嘈杂,将音色调为“洪亮”模式,适当降低语速。

    • 语速命令:{"speed": 80} (范围 50-200,100为正常)

    • 音色命令:{"voice": 0} (0为女声,1为男声)

  2. 多设备协同:如果仓库面积大,可部署多台音箱。HTTP接口支持并发请求,只需改变 device 参数即可分区播报。例如,A 区只接收收货指令,B 区只接收发货指令。

  3. 私有化部署(Option):对于信息安全要求比较高的仓库(如军备、医药),芯步支持私有化部署。你可以将消息服务器部署在本地局域网,所有 API 请求不经过外网,极大降低了网络延迟并提高了安全性

6. 常见问题排障

  • 音箱无反应: 检查网络连接(有线网口灯是否闪烁),确认设备 ID 是否与控制台一致。

  • 语音卡顿: 检查 Wi-Fi 信号强度或网络带宽;如果使用 4G 版本,检查信号强度。

  • 签名错误: 核对 AppSecret 是否正确,特别注意 md5 的顺序(先加密 Secret,再拼接 ts,再整体加密)。

通过以上步骤,开发者仅需编写简单的 HTTP 请求代码,即可在短时间内将传统仓库升级为具有实时语音交互能力的智能仓库,提升作业效率与准确性。